This mission statement will explain the objectives
of the American Council Of The Blind Of Tuscarawas Valley (ACB Tusc. Valley).
This chapter will do all it can to improve the quality of life for the blind in
this county and the Surrounding area. This chapter of the ACB was established on
January 1, 2001. We are a social group that is planning to be active in
educating the public, working with visually impaired children and adults, also
working with and guiding our legislative representatives on issues that deal
with the blind. We also bring back information from other chapters in Ohio and
across the country via conventions and through the Internet. This information
pertains to the latest technologies that assist in reading, mobility and other
needs that a person that is blind has to deal with on a daily basis. We also
loan equipment to blind or visually impaired (if available) to
assist them in reading or other tasks.
